An electrolyte additive of bromoxoindole enables uniform Li-ion flux and tunable Li<sub>2</sub>S deposition for high-performance lithium–sulfur batteries
Jinxuan Zou, Pengxuan He, Yufang Zhang, Dong Cai, Shuo Yang, Ying He, Yangyang Dong, Kuikui Xiao, Xuemei Zhou, Huagui Nie, Zhi Yang
Abstract
6-Bromoxoindole, an electrolyte additive, enables the lithium–sulfur battery to operate stably under high-loading, lean-electrolyte, and low-temperature conditions simultaneously.
